* UnrelatedBrothers: Averted. The Maivia and Snuka lines may not be direct biological relatives to the Anoa'i/Fatu, but they are considered a part of the family in real life due to covenants with Afa and Sika's father. So seeing The Tonga Kid be called Superfly's cousin, or Tamina and Nia Jax refer to each other and The Usos as their cousins (and vice versa), or Rikishi reference both The High Chief and his own brothers in his confession speech to The Rock, is not some corporate tactic by promoters to associate random Polynesians to one another, but a reflection of how they all truly see each other in reality. Case and point: in a posthumous Instagram post reflecting on Snuka's final days, Rock calls Superfly "uncle". The Samoan Dynasty Family Tree graphic shown by The Rock at the [=WrestleMania XL=] press conference on February 8, 2024 also includes Anoa'i, Fatu, and Snuka members. While not officially grafted into the tree, Haku and his sons are considered part of the Dynasty as well, with both Afa and Lance Anoa'i confirming this; Haku is another who The Rock calls an uncle and was even the best man at his wedding. This would lead directly into Tama's WWE Bloodline debut.
